针对不同需求,前端低代码和开源低代码的优缺点细分解析!
随着IT技术的进步,软件开发已经成为了非常重要的一项任务。虽然现在的编程技术已经非常发达,但开发一个完整的软件仍然需要很长的时间和大量的人力物力。但是,低代码开发技术的发展使这一过程变得更容易。在低代码开发中,开发人员使用一个易于使用的平台,无需编写代码,从而可以更快地创建应用程序。前端低代码和开源低代码都是低代码开发的一种方式,但它们具有不同的优缺点。在本文中,我们将详细分析这两种技术,以帮助企业了解如何选择合适的开发方式。
前端低代码的优点:
1. 易于使用:由于前端低代码开发平台允许开发人员使用可视化的组件和图形界面,因此这种开发方式更容易学习和理解。
2. 快速开发:无需编写繁琐的代码,前端低代码的开发速度要比传统的开发方式快得多。这使得应用程序的开发进程可以减少到几天或几周,而不是几个月。
3. 提高效率:前端低代码开发方式可减少开发人员的工作量。这使他们能够更快、更专注地完成任务,同时避免繁琐而无意义的代码编写。
前端低代码的缺点:
1. 限制:前端低代码开发平台具有一定的限制,开发人员无法使用自己想要的语言或框架。这可能会对更大、更复杂的项目产生影响。
2. 控制权:一旦应用程序被构建,开发人员将无法控制代码库,这使得对应用程序进行深度修改变得更加困难。
3. 需要专业的开发人员:前端低代码平台需要专业人员处理配置和部署。因此,如果没有经验的开发人员尝试这种开发方式,可能会遇到一些问题。
开源低代码的优点:
1. 可定制性:开源低代码平台是一种自由、开源的资源,使得开发人员有很多选择,可以根据自己的需求定制。
2. 灵活性:开源低代码平台可以适应更多的应用场景和需求,能够处理更复杂、更大型的项目,提供更多的控制权和灵活性。
3. 便宜、免费:使用开源低代码平台通常不需要付费使用费用。这极大地降低了中小企业使用低代码开发平台的成本。
开源低代码的缺点:
1. 困难:相对于前端低代码开发方式而言,开源低代码的学习和使用难度比较大,需要有一定的技能和经验。
2. 不稳定:由于是开源平台,可能存在资金和人工不足的问题。这一点也决定了开源低代码平台的稳定性和可靠性达不到任何商业产品的水平。
3. 需要高级的开发人员:使用开源低代码需要进行较多的自定义和集成工作,因此需要具备高级开发人员的经验和技能。
综上所述,前端低代码和开源低代码两种低代码开发方式各有优缺点。企业需要根据自身的实际需求和开发经验,选择更适合自己的开发方式。总之,使用低代码开发技术可以帮助企业更快地构建应用程序,提高开发效率,降低开发成本,从而获得更高的竞争力。
前端低代码的优点:
1. 易于使用:由于前端低代码开发平台允许开发人员使用可视化的组件和图形界面,因此这种开发方式更容易学习和理解。
2. 快速开发:无需编写繁琐的代码,前端低代码的开发速度要比传统的开发方式快得多。这使得应用程序的开发进程可以减少到几天或几周,而不是几个月。
3. 提高效率:前端低代码开发方式可减少开发人员的工作量。这使他们能够更快、更专注地完成任务,同时避免繁琐而无意义的代码编写。
前端低代码的缺点:
1. 限制:前端低代码开发平台具有一定的限制,开发人员无法使用自己想要的语言或框架。这可能会对更大、更复杂的项目产生影响。
2. 控制权:一旦应用程序被构建,开发人员将无法控制代码库,这使得对应用程序进行深度修改变得更加困难。
3. 需要专业的开发人员:前端低代码平台需要专业人员处理配置和部署。因此,如果没有经验的开发人员尝试这种开发方式,可能会遇到一些问题。
开源低代码的优点:
1. 可定制性:开源低代码平台是一种自由、开源的资源,使得开发人员有很多选择,可以根据自己的需求定制。
2. 灵活性:开源低代码平台可以适应更多的应用场景和需求,能够处理更复杂、更大型的项目,提供更多的控制权和灵活性。
3. 便宜、免费:使用开源低代码平台通常不需要付费使用费用。这极大地降低了中小企业使用低代码开发平台的成本。
开源低代码的缺点:
1. 困难:相对于前端低代码开发方式而言,开源低代码的学习和使用难度比较大,需要有一定的技能和经验。
2. 不稳定:由于是开源平台,可能存在资金和人工不足的问题。这一点也决定了开源低代码平台的稳定性和可靠性达不到任何商业产品的水平。
3. 需要高级的开发人员:使用开源低代码需要进行较多的自定义和集成工作,因此需要具备高级开发人员的经验和技能。
综上所述,前端低代码和开源低代码两种低代码开发方式各有优缺点。企业需要根据自身的实际需求和开发经验,选择更适合自己的开发方式。总之,使用低代码开发技术可以帮助企业更快地构建应用程序,提高开发效率,降低开发成本,从而获得更高的竞争力。
-
本文分类: 常见问题
-
浏览次数: 463 次浏览
-
发布日期: 2023-05-31 19:18:14